The hexadecimal color code #B6DFEC corresponds to the code RGB( 182, 223, 236 ). It's a shade of Blue. This color is a combination of red (at 0,71 level), green (at 0,87 level) and blue (at 0,93 level). Its brightness is 81% and its saturation is 58%. It is composed of red at 28%, green at 34% and blue at 36%.

The complementary color #492013 is the color exactly opposite to #B6DFEC on the color wheel. The triadic palette is created by selecting two colors that are evenly spaced on the color wheel.

Uses of #B6DFEC in CSS

When using #B6DFEC as the background color, consider selecting a darker text color for improved readability. If you want to use #B6DFEC as the text color, prefer a dark background, such as Black.
